About Janghyun Yoo
Janghyun Yoo is a scholar working on Structural Biology, Biophysics and Virology, having authored 13 papers that have together received 350 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ced Fluorescence Microscopy Techniques (6 papers), Protein Structure and Dynamics (5 papers) and Monoclonal and Polyclonal Antibodies Research (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Biophysics (75 citations), Structural Biology (16 citations) and Molecular Biology (258 citations). Janghyun Yoo has collaborated with scholars based in United States and South Korea. Frequent co-authors include Hoi Sung Chung, Tae‐Young Yoon, Fanjie Meng, John M. Louis, Irina V. Gopich, Ji Young Ryu, Hyojin Kang, Giltsu Choi, Woohyun Kim and Jaewook Kim. Their work appears in journ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Journal of the American Chemical Society and Nature Communications.
